Output 958042f03fe0f8c93c24497386ac3d1ed57bf1292630ab2c1464140e95b08e59:0

value
28531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c18efb4411a748769e7347faaa6fecd7ab9b50d OP_EQUAL
address
3MknTMVAZG2CtdkLUm8C7nY7geNHsEzWHM
transaction
958042f03fe0f8c93c24497386ac3d1ed57bf1292630ab2c1464140e95b08e59
spent
true